如何为AI助手开发添加知识问答功能
在一个繁忙的科技园区内,有一家名为“智联科技”的公司,这家公司专注于人工智能领域的研发。公司创始人李明是一位年轻有为的科技创业者,他带领团队研发出了一款名为“小智”的AI助手。这款助手在市场上颇受欢迎,但李明并不满足于此,他希望通过为“小智”添加知识问答功能,让这款AI助手更加智能化、人性化。
李明的想法源于一次偶然的经历。有一天,他在家中使用“小智”时,无意中提到了一个历史问题:“请问秦始皇统一六国是在哪个朝代?”然而,令他失望的是,“小智”只能给出一个简单的回答:“抱歉,我无法回答这个问题。”这让李明意识到,尽管“小智”在日常生活中能够帮助用户完成许多任务,但在知识问答方面还有很大的提升空间。
于是,李明决定为公司立项,开发“小智”的知识问答功能。他深知这项任务的重要性,因为这不仅关系到产品的竞争力,更是公司未来发展的关键。在项目启动会上,李明向大家阐述了这一想法,并提出了以下开发策略:
一、组建专业团队
为了确保知识问答功能的开发质量,李明从公司内部选拔了一批优秀的工程师、数据科学家和产品经理,组成了一个专门的项目团队。团队成员各司其职,共同为项目的成功贡献力量。
二、收集海量数据
知识问答功能的核心在于拥有丰富的知识库。为了实现这一目标,项目团队开始四处搜集数据。他们从互联网、图书馆、专业数据库等渠道获取了大量历史、地理、科技、文化等方面的知识,并将其整理成结构化的数据。
三、研发问答引擎
在数据准备就绪后,项目团队开始研发问答引擎。他们采用先进的自然语言处理技术,使“小智”能够理解用户的问题,并根据问题从知识库中检索出相关答案。为了提高问答的准确性,团队还引入了机器学习算法,不断优化问答引擎的性能。
四、优化用户体验
在功能开发过程中,项目团队始终将用户体验放在首位。他们设计了简洁明了的交互界面,让用户能够轻松地提出问题。同时,针对不同用户的需求,团队还提供了多种问答模式,如单选题、多选题、填空题等。
五、持续迭代升级
为了确保知识问答功能的持续优化,项目团队制定了详细的迭代计划。他们定期收集用户反馈,针对用户提出的问题和需求进行改进。此外,团队还关注行业动态,不断引入新技术,为“小智”注入新的活力。
经过几个月的努力,知识问答功能终于研发成功。当“小智”再次面对那个历史问题时,它不仅给出了准确的答案,还详细解释了秦始皇统一六国的历史背景。用户们对这一功能的满意度大幅提升,纷纷为“小智”点赞。
然而,李明并没有因此而满足。他深知,在人工智能领域,竞争激烈,只有不断创新,才能保持领先地位。于是,他开始思考如何进一步拓展“小智”的知识问答功能。
首先,李明计划与各大知识平台合作,将更多领域的知识引入“小智”的知识库。这样一来,用户在提问时,将能够获得更全面、更准确的答案。
其次,李明希望“小智”能够具备自我学习的能力。通过分析用户提问和回答的过程,不断优化问答引擎,提高“小智”的智能水平。
最后,李明还打算将“小智”的知识问答功能与其他产品线相结合,如智能家居、在线教育等,为用户提供更加便捷、智能的服务。
在李明的带领下,智联科技团队正不断努力,为“小智”的知识问答功能注入更多活力。相信在不久的将来,这款AI助手将成为用户生活中的得力助手,为人们带来更加美好的生活体验。而这一切,都始于那个关于秦始皇统一六国的问题。
猜你喜欢:AI对话开发